Transaction 6580b0aecc51a8785ce116ea01f1871ef0ccd249a79c648fca8b8f4bb73ccb3b

2 Input
2 Outputs
  • 6580b0aecc51a8785ce116ea01f1871ef0ccd249a79c648fca8b8f4bb73ccb3b:0
  • value  24055656
    address  3HC3wwsvbySASG7PZg1R8HvSNbqP4hn8kX
  • 6580b0aecc51a8785ce116ea01f1871ef0ccd249a79c648fca8b8f4bb73ccb3b:1
  • value  73314711
    address  bc1q3uzuz9sx5twufucqedlqlc0kt9p9star2u489u